General description
Microtubule-associated protein tau (UniProt: P10636; also known as Neurofibrillary tangle protein Paired helical filament-tau (PHF-tau)) is encoded by the MAPT (also known as MAPTL, MTBT1, TAU) gene (Gene ID: 4137) in human. Tau is a highly abundant protein found predominantly in the nervous system. Its primary role is to stabilize and support microtubule assembly, which are essential for maintaining the structure and function of nerve cells. It is present throughout the brain, particularly in regions involved in memory and cognition. MAPT gene consists of multiple exons that undergo alternative splicing, resulting in the generation of different isoforms that differ in the number and arrangement of repeats in the microtubule-binding domain. The expression of the MAPT transcripts varies and depends on the stage of neuronal maturation and neuron type. Aberrant aggregation and accumulation of tau protein have been linked to several neurodegenerative diseases collectively known as tauopathies. The most common tauopathy is Alzheimer′s disease, where hyperphosphorylated tau protein forms neurofibrillary tangles inside neurons. Other tauopathies include frontotemporal dementia, progressive supranuclear palsy, and cortico-basal degeneration. These diseases are characterized by cognitive decline, motor disturbances, and memory loss.
Immunogen
His-tagged, recombinant, human Tau isoform 1N3R aggregates produced with arachidonic acid.
Application
Quality Control Testing
Evaluated by Western Blotting with His-tagged, Human recombinant Tau, isoform 1N4R. Western Blotting Analysis: A 1:1,000 dilution of this antibody detected His-tagged, Human, recombinant Tau isoform 1N4R.
Tested Applications
Enzyme Immunoassay (ELISA): Serial dilutions from a representative lot detected Tau monomers or Tau aggregates induced with arachidonic acid in ELISA (Courtesy of Nicholas Kanaan, Ph.D., Michigan State University, USA).
Western Blotting Analysis: A representative lot detected recombinant, human Tau isoform 2N4R monomers and aggregates, 2N3R monomers and aggregates, and mouse Tau monomers. (Courtesy of Nicholas Kanaan, Ph.D., Michigan State University, USA).
Immunohistochemistry Applications: A representative lot detected Tau in Alzheimer′s diseased (AD) brain (superior temporal cortex, STG) tissue sections. Human disease sections had to be treated with phosphatase (dephosphorylates tau) to obtain reactivity suggesting tau in human AD is phosphorylated at its epitope. (Courtesy of Nicholas Kanaan, Ph.D., Michigan State University, USA).

Biochem/physiol Actions
Clone 10C5 is a mouse monoclonal antibody that detects Tau. It targets an epitope within 52 amino acids in the proline-rich region (PR-1) of human Tau.
Physical form
Purified mouse monoclonal antibody IgG2b in buffer containing 0.1 M Tris-Glycine (pH 7.4), 150 mM NaCl with 0.05% sodium azide.
